ت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
بني التحكم و حالاتها في الجافا + امثلة عملية .. (2)
#2
الشكل العام للكود :

كود :
[color=#000000][COLOR=#007700]switch ([/color][color=#0000bb]x[/color][COLOR=#007700])
    {
        case [/COLOR][color=#0000bb]1 [/color][COLOR=#007700]:
           [/COLOR][color=#0000bb]Statement1[/color][COLOR=#007700];
            break;
        case [/COLOR][color=#0000bb]2 [/color][COLOR=#007700]:
            [/COLOR][color=#0000bb]Statement1[/color][COLOR=#007700];
            break;
        default :
            [/COLOR][COLOR=#ff8000]// unknown Statement1          
    [/COLOR][COLOR=#007700]}  
[/COLOR][/COLOR]

مثال لبرنامج يقوم بتحويل الارقام المدخلة الي المسمي الحرفي لها :

كود :
[color=#000000][COLOR=#0000bb] int x [/color][color=#007700]= [/color][color=#0000bb]Integer[/color][color=#007700].[/color][color=#0000bb]parseInt[/color][color=#007700]([/color][color=#0000bb]jTextField1[/color][color=#007700].[/color][color=#0000bb]getText[/color][COLOR=#007700]());
    switch ([/COLOR][color=#0000bb]x[/color][COLOR=#007700])
    {
        case [/COLOR][color=#0000bb]1 [/color][COLOR=#007700]:
            [/COLOR][color=#0000bb]jLabel1[/color][color=#007700].[/color][color=#0000bb]setText[/color][color=#007700]([/color][color=#dd0000]"Number One"[/color][COLOR=#007700]);
            break;
            case [/COLOR][color=#0000bb]2 [/color][COLOR=#007700]:
            [/COLOR][color=#0000bb]jLabel1[/color][color=#007700].[/color][color=#0000bb]setText[/color][color=#007700]([/color][color=#dd0000]"Number Two"[/color][COLOR=#007700]);
            break;
                case [/COLOR][color=#0000bb]3 [/color][COLOR=#007700]:
            [/COLOR][color=#0000bb]jLabel1[/color][color=#007700].[/color][color=#0000bb]setText[/color][color=#007700]([/color][color=#dd0000]"Number Three"[/color][COLOR=#007700]);
            break;
                    case [/COLOR][color=#0000bb]4 [/color][COLOR=#007700]:
            [/COLOR][color=#0000bb]jLabel1[/color][color=#007700].[/color][color=#0000bb]setText[/color][color=#007700]([/color][color=#dd0000]"Number Four"[/color][COLOR=#007700]);
            break;
                        case [/COLOR][color=#0000bb]5 [/color][COLOR=#007700]:
            [/COLOR][color=#0000bb]jLabel1[/color][color=#007700].[/color][color=#0000bb]setText[/color][color=#007700]([/color][color=#dd0000]"Number Five"[/color][COLOR=#007700]);
            break;
                          default :
            [/COLOR][color=#0000bb]jLabel1[/color][color=#007700].[/color][color=#0000bb]setText[/color][color=#007700]([/color][color=#dd0000]"Unknown Entry"[/color][COLOR=#007700]);                
    }  
[/COLOR][/COLOR]

اخيرا مع الروابط :
----------------------

رابط مشروع هذا الموضوع :
للحالة if :
http://vb4arb.com/vb/uploaded/18_01350636882.rar
للحالة case :
http://vb4arb.com/vb/uploaded/18_11350636882.rar

و السلام عليكم ورحمة الله ....



}}}
تم الشكر بواسطة:


الردود في هذا الموضوع
بني التحكم و حالاتها في الجافا + امثلة عملية .. (2) - بواسطة Raggi Tech - 19-10-12, 12:55 PM


الت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م